Marijuana is grown from one of 2 sources: a seed or a clone. Seeds bring genetic information from two moms and dad plants and can express many various mixes of characteristics: some from the mother, some from the dad, and some traits from both. In industrial cannabis production, normally, growers will plant many seeds of one stress and choose the best plant. They will then take clones from that individual plant, which enables constant genes for mass production. feminized marijauna seeds. If marijuana is legal in your state, you can buy seeds or clones from a regional dispensary, or online through numerous seed banks.
Growing from seed can produce a stronger plant with more solid genes. Plants grown from seed can be more hearty as young plants when compared to clones, mainly due to the fact that seeds have a strong taproot. You can plant seeds directly into an outside garden in early spring, even in cool, wet environments. If growing outside, some growers choose to germinate seeds within because they are fragile in the beginning stages of development. Inside, you can give weed seedlings additional light to help them along, and after that transplant them outside when huge enough. Feminized cannabis seeds will produce only female plants for getting buds, so there is no need to remove males or fret about female plants getting pollinated. Feminized seeds are produced by causing the monoecious condition in a female cannabis plantthe resulting seeds are nearly similar to the self-pollinated female parent, as only one set of genes exists.
This is accomplished through several approaches: By spraying the plant with a solution of colloidal silver, a liquid containing tiny particles of silver, Through a technique known as rodelization, in which a female plant pressed past maturity can pollinate another woman, Spraying seeds with gibberellic acid, a hormonal agent that activates germination (this is much less common) A lot of skilled or business growers will not utilize feminized seeds due to the fact that they just consist of one set of genes, and these need to never ever be utilized for reproducing purposes - autoflowering seeds. However, a lot of starting growers begin with feminized seeds because they eliminate the worry of needing to deal with male plants.

They are easy to grow since you do not have to stress over light cycles and how much light a plant receives. A lot of marijuana plants begin flowering when the quantity of light they receive on a daily basis decreases. Outdoors, this takes place when the sun begins setting earlier in the day as the season turns from summertime to fall. Indoor growers can manage when a plant flowers by decreasing the everyday quantity of light plants receive from 18 hours to 12 hours - autoflower marijuana seeds.
Autoflowers can be begun in early spring and will flower during the longest days of summer season, making the most of high quality light to grow yields. Or, if you get a late start in the growing season, you can begin autoflowers in May or June and harvest in the fall (feminized weed seeds). Also, autoflower plants are smallperfect for closet grows or any small grow, or growing outdoors where you don't want your neighbors to see what you depend on. A couple big drawbacks, though: Autoflower pressures are known for being less potent. Also, because they are little in stature, they normally do not produce huge yields.

CBD, or cannabidiol, is among the chemical componentsknown collectively as cannabinoidsfound in the marijuana plant. Over the years, people have selected plants for high-THC material, making cannabis with high levels of CBD unusual. The genetic paths through which THC is manufactured by the plant are different than those for CBD production. Cannabis utilized for hemp production has been selected for other characteristics, including a low THC material, so regarding adhere to the 2018 Farm Expense.
As interest in CBD as a medicine has actually grown, lots of breeders have crossed high-CBD hemp with cannabis. These pressures have little or no THC, 1:1 ratios of THC and CBD, or some have a high-THC material together with substantial quantities of CBD (3% or more). Seeds for these varieties are now extensively offered online and through dispensaries. It must be kept in mind, nevertheless, that any plant grown from these seeds is not guaranteed to produce high levels of CBD, as it takes lots of years to create a seed line that produces consistent results - what are feminized seeds. A grower seeking to produce cannabis with a particular THC to CBD ratio will require to grow from an evaluated and shown clone or seed.

Cannabis seeds require 3 things to germinate: water, heat, and air. There are numerous methods to sprout seeds, but for the most common and most basic technique, you will need: 2 tidy plates, Four paper towels, Seeds, Pure water Take four sheets of paper towels and soak them with pure water. The towels must be soaked however should not have excess water running off.
Then, place the cannabis seeds a minimum of an inch apart from each other and cover them with the remaining two water-soaked paper towels. To produce a dark, safeguarded space, take another plate and turn it over to cover the seeds, like a dome. Make sure the location the seeds are in is warm, somewhere in between 70-85F. After finishing these actions, it's time to wait. Examine the paper towels when a day to make sure they're still saturated, and if they are losing wetness, use more water to keep the seeds delighted - feminized hemp seeds. Some seeds sprout extremely quickly while others can take a while, however normally, seeds need to sprout in 3-10 days.
A seed has actually germinated once the seed divides and a single grow appears. The sprout is the taproot, which will end up being the primary stem of the plant, and seeing it suggests effective germination. It's crucial to keep the fragile seed sterilized, so do not touch the seed or taproot as it starts to divide.
